@charset "utf-8";
* { margin: 0; padding: 0;}
a { text-decoration: none;}
ul, li { list-style: outside none none;}
img { border: 0 none;}
.clear { clear: both;}
.dl_foot,.yuyue,.float{ font-size:15px;}
#LRdiv0{font-size:14px;}
html{ font-size:635%;}
.bgbox{min-height:100%; max-width:640px; margin:0 auto; padding:0; font-size:0.14rem; font-family:"微软雅黑";}
.cen640{width:100%; max-width:640px; margin:0 auto; overflow:hidden;}
.cen640 img{ width:100%; vertical-align:top; float:left;}

.jsjz1{
	width:100%;
	margin:0 auto;
	overflow:hidden;
}
.jsjz2{
	width:2.8rem;
	margin:0 auto;
	overflow:hidden;
}
.pp1{
	text-align:center;
	font-size:0.12rem;
	color:#373737;
	margin-top:0.2rem;
	margin-bottom:0.16rem;
}
.pp1 span{
	font-size:0.2rem;
	font-weight:bold;
}
.pp2{
	font-size:0.11rem;
	color:#4e4e4e;
	line-height:0.18rem;
	margin-bottom:0.19rem;
}
.jsjz3{
	background:url(../images/jsjz_03.jpg) no-repeat center;
	background-size:100%;
	width:100%;
	height:2.42rem;
	overflow:hidden;
}
.jsjz3 img{
	width:2.43rem;
	height:1.37rem;
	float:left;
	margin-left: 0.37rem;
margin-top: 0.12rem;
}
.pp3{
	font-size:0.2rem;
	color:#373737;text-align:center;
	width:100%;
	float:left;
	font-weight:bold;
	margin-top:0.28rem;
	margin-bottom:0.15rem;
}
.jsjz4{
	width:2.94rem;
	margin:0 auto;
	overflow:hidden;
	margin-top:0.3rem;
	margin-bottom:0.12rem;
}
.jsjz4 h2{
	font-size:0.2rem;
	color:#373737;
	text-align:center;
}
.pp4{
	font-size:0.12rem;
	color:#373737;text-align:center;
	margin-bottom:0.17rem;
}
.jsjz5{
	width:100%;
	margin:0 auto;
	overflow:hidden;
	border-bottom:0.005rem dashed #aeaeae;
	padding-bottom:0.17rem;
	margin-bottom:0.2rem;
}
.jsjz5 p{
	font-size:0.1rem;
	line-height:0.18rem;
	color:#4e4e4e;
	margin-bottom: 0.05rem;
}
.jsjz5 p span{
	width:1.58rem;
	line-height:0.2rem;
	background-color:#c87039;
	text-align:center;
	display:block;
	font-size:0.12rem;
	color:#ffffff;
	margin-bottom: 0.05rem;
}
.jsjz5 img{
	width:2.88rem;
	height:1.58rem;
	display:block;
	margin:0 auto;
	overflow:hidden;
}
.jsjz6{
	width:100%;
	margin:0 auto;
	overflow:hidden;
	border-bottom:0.005rem dashed #aeaeae;
	padding-bottom:0.17rem;
	margin-bottom:0.2rem;
}
.jsjz6 p{
	font-size:0.1rem;
	line-height:0.18rem;
	color:#4e4e4e;
	width:1.17rem;
	float:left;
}
.jsjz6 p span{
	width:1.17rem;
	line-height:0.2rem;
	background-color:#c87039;
	text-align:center;
	display:block;
	font-size:0.12rem;
	color:#ffffff;
	margin-bottom: 0.05rem;
}
.jsjz6 img{
	width:1.64rem;
	height:1.38rem;
	float:left;
	margin-left:0.08rem;
	overflow:hidden;
	margin-top:0.02rem;
}

.jsjz7{
	width:100%;
	margin:0 auto;
	overflow:hidden;
	border-bottom:0.005rem dashed #aeaeae;
	padding-bottom:0.17rem;
	margin-bottom:0.2rem;
}
.jsjz7 p{
	font-size:0.1rem;
	line-height:0.18rem;
	color:#4e4e4e;
	width:1.17rem;
	float:left;
}
.jsjz7 p span{
	width:1.17rem;
	line-height:0.2rem;
	background-color:#c87039;
	text-align:center;
	display:block;
	font-size:0.12rem;
	color:#ffffff;
	margin-bottom: 0.05rem;
}
.jsjz7 img{
	width:1.64rem;
	height:1.38rem;
	float:left;
	margin-right:0.08rem;
	overflow:hidden;
	margin-top:0.02rem;
}
.jsjz71{
	width:100%;
	margin:0 auto;
	overflow:hidden;
}
.jsjz71 p{
	font-size:0.1rem;
	line-height:0.18rem;
	color:#4e4e4e;
}
.jsjz71 p span{
	width:1.58rem;
	line-height:0.2rem;
	background-color:#c87039;
	text-align:center;
	display:block;
	font-size:0.12rem;
	color:#ffffff;
	margin-bottom: 0.05rem;
}
.form1{
	width:2.79rem;
	margin:0 auto;
	overflow:hidden;
	margin-top:0.25rem;
}
.form1 p{
	font-size:0.12rem;
	color:#373737;
	text-align:center;
	margin-bottom: 0.15rem;
}
.form1 p span{
	font-size:0.2rem;
	font-weight:bold;
}
.input{
	width:2.67rem;
	line-height:0.35rem;
	height:0.35rem;
	padding-left:0.1rem;
	font-size:0.12rem;
	color:#4e4e4e;
	border:0.005rem solid #8c8c8c;
	margin-bottom:0.12rem;
	background-color:#f2f2f2;
}
.bt{
	width:2.78rem;
	line-height:0.35rem;
	height:0.35rem;
	text-align:center;
	font-size:0.15rem;
	color:#ffffff;
	border:0.005rem solid #8c8c8c;
	margin-bottom:0.29rem;
	background-color:#8d0000;	
}
.jsjz8{
	width:100%;
	margin:0 auto;
	overflow:hidden;
	margin-top:0.46rem;
	margin-bottom:0.16rem;
}
.jsjz8 p{
	font-size:0.12rem;
	color:#373737;text-align:center;
}
.jsjz8 p span{
	font-size:0.2rem;
	font-weight:bold;
}
.aa1{
	width:3.01rem;
	line-height:0.3rem;
	text-align:center;
	font-size:0.15rem;
	color:#ffffff;
	border:0.005rem solid #8c8c8c;
	margin-bottom:0.22rem;
	background-color:#8d0000;
float: left;	
margin-left: 0.1rem;
}
.hh2{
	font-size:0.2rem;
	color:#373737;
	text-align:center;
	margin-top:0.21rem;
	margin-bottom:0.19rem;
}
#anbox{
margin-bottom: 0.2rem;

width: 100%;

overflow: hidden;	
}
#anbox .hd{
margin-top: 0.12rem;
margin-left: 1.2rem;	
}
#anbox .hd ul li{
	font-size:0;
	width:0.12rem;
	height:0.12rem;
	border-radius:0.12rem;
	float:left;
	background-color:#c39f8f;
	margin-left:0.09rem;
}
#anbox .hd ul li.on{
	background-color:#944d2c;
}
.jsjz9{
	width:100%;
	background-color:#7b2f15;
	overflow:hidden;
}
.jsjz9 p{
	font-size:0.12rem;
	text-align:center;
	color:#ffffff;
	margin-top:0.25rem;
	margin-bottom:0.15rem;
}
.jsjz9 p span{
	font-size:0.2rem;
	font-weight:bold;
}
.hh1{
	font-size:0.2rem;
	color:#373737;text-align:center;
	margin-top:0.15rem;
	margin-bottom:0.13rem;
}















#bg {width: 100%; height: 100%; background-color: #000; position:fixed; top: 0; left: 0; z-index: 2; opacity:0.5; filter: alpha(opacity=50);display:none;} 
#loading{ width:0.2rem; height:0.2rem; position:fixed; margin:-0.1rem 0 0 -0.1rem; z-index: 3; top:50%;left:50%; display:none;}
#loading img{width:100%; vertical-align:top; float:left;}
@media screen and (max-width: 480px){

	}